We compared two Professional market GPUs: 1024MB VRAM Quadro Plex 2100 D4 and 6GB VRAM Tesla C2075 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A Tesla C2075 's Advantages
Released 3 years late
More VRAM (6GB vs 1024GB)
Larger VRAM bandwidth (150.3GB/s vs 51.20GB/s)
320 additional rendering cores
Lower TDP (247W vs 640W)
